Solution for -6x+10=40-x equation:


Simplifying
-6x + 10 = 40 + -1x

Reorder the terms:
10 + -6x = 40 + -1x

Solving
10 + -6x = 40 + -1x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add 'x' to each side of the equation.
10 + -6x + x = 40 + -1x + x

Combine like terms: -6x + x = -5x
10 + -5x = 40 + -1x + x

Combine like terms: -1x + x = 0
10 + -5x = 40 + 0
10 + -5x = 40

Add '-10' to each side of the equation.
10 + -10 + -5x = 40 + -10

Combine like terms: 10 + -10 = 0
0 + -5x = 40 + -10
-5x = 40 + -10

Combine like terms: 40 + -10 = 30
-5x = 30

Divide each side by '-5'.
x = -6

Simplifying
x = -6
